Universal Health Realty Income Trust · Q3 2023 earnings
Q3 2023 earnings · · Investor relations
Briefing
Reported third quarter financial results with net income of $3.9 million and FFO of $11.2 million.
Universal Health Realty Income Trust reported a decrease in net income for the third quarter of 2023 compared to the same period in 2022, primarily due to increased interest expenses. However, there was a net increase in income generated at various properties. The company acquired a medical office building in McAllen, Texas, and construction was substantially completed on the Sierra Medical Plaza I in Reno, Nevada.
- Net income decreased to $3.9 million, or $0.28 per diluted share, compared to $4.8 million, or $0.35 per diluted share, in Q3 2022.
- Funds from operations (FFO) decreased to $11.2 million, or $0.81 per diluted share, compared to $11.8 million, or $0.86 per diluted share, in Q3 2022.
- Acquired the McAllen Doctor's Center, a medical office building in McAllen, Texas, for approximately $7.5 million.
- Construction was substantially completed on the Sierra Medical Plaza I, an 86,000 square foot MOB located in Reno, Nevada, with an estimated cost of approximately $35 million.

Forward guidance
Future operating expenses related to vacant properties are estimated to be approximately $1.3 million in the aggregate during the full year of 2023 (excluding the demolition costs incurred in connection with the property in Chicago, Illinois), and will be incurred by us during the time they remain owned and unleased.
Headwinds
- Future operations and financial results of our tenants, and in turn ours, could be materially impacted by various developments including, but not limited to, decreases in staffing availability and related increases to wage expense experienced by our tenants resulting from the nationwide shortage of nurses and other clinical staff and support personnel, the impact of government and administrative regulation of the health care industry; declining patient volumes and unfavorable changes in payer mix caused by deteriorating macroeconomic conditions (including increases in uninsured and underinsured patients as the result of business closings and layoffs); potential disruptions related to supplies required for our tenants’ employees and patients; and potential increases to other expenditures.
- In addition, the increase in interest rates has substantially increased our borrowings costs and reduced our ability to access the capital markets on favorable terms.
- Additional increases in interest rates could have a significant unfavorable impact on our future results of operations and the resulting effect on the capital markets could adversely affect our ability to carry out our strategy.
- Should these properties continue to remain owned and unleased for an extended period of time, or should we incur substantial renovation or additional demolition costs to make the properties suitable for other operators/tenants/buyers, our future results of operations could be materially unfavorably impacted.
- Many of the factors that could affect our future results are beyond our control or ability to predict, including the impact of the COVID-19 pandemic.
